From 5b58fce5de404dc7ae2d73e635b189bfc7631976 Mon Sep 17 00:00:00 2001 From: kindlm Date: Tue, 24 Mar 2015 15:44:04 +0100 Subject: [PATCH] Kleiner Fehler bei Detailauswertung, Korrektur CMS M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it ParseBool bei Detailauswertung eingefügt. Vorschau bei CMS-Admin auch, wenn Content nicht sichtbar --- cis/testtool/admin/auswertung_detail.php | 59 +++++++++++++----------- cms/admin.php | 6 ++- 2 files changed, 38 insertions(+), 27 deletions(-) diff --git a/cis/testtool/admin/auswertung_detail.php b/cis/testtool/admin/auswertung_detail.php index da7573bdf..4d70039e3 100644 --- a/cis/testtool/admin/auswertung_detail.php +++ b/cis/testtool/admin/auswertung_detail.php @@ -117,35 +117,40 @@ if(isset($_GET['show'])) $qry.=" AND gebiet_id='".addslashes($gebiet_id)."'"; $qry.=") as a ORDER BY gebiet_id, nummer"; - //echo $qry.'

'; if($result = $db->db_query($qry)) { - if($row = $db->db_fetch_object($result,0)) + if($db->db_num_rows($result)>0) { - echo '
- Bearbeitungszeit: '.$row->zeit.'
- Multipleresponse: '.($row->multipleresponse==true?'Ja':'Nein').'
- Gestellte Fragen: '.$row->maxfragen.'
- Zufallsfrage: '.($row->zufallfrage==true?'Ja':'Nein').'
- Zufallsvorschlag: '.($row->zufallvorschlag==true?'Ja':'Nein').'
- Startlevel: '.($row->level_start!=''?$row->level_start:'Keines').'
- Höheres Level nach: '.($row->level_sprung_auf!=''?$row->level_sprung_auf.' richtigen Antwort(en)':'-').'
- Niedrigeres Level nach: '.($row->level_sprung_ab!=''?$row->level_sprung_ab.' falschen Antwort(en)':'-').'
- Levelgleichverteilung: '.($row->levelgleichverteilung==true?'Ja':'Nein').'
- Maximalpunkte: '.$row->maxpunkte.'
- Antworten pro Zeile: '.$row->antwortenprozeile.'
-
- - - - - - - - - - '; - } + if($row = $db->db_fetch_object($result,0)) + { + echo '
+ Bearbeitungszeit: '.$row->zeit.'
+ Multipleresponse: '.($db->db_parse_bool($row->multipleresponse)==true?'Ja':'Nein').'
+ Gestellte Fragen: '.$row->maxfragen.'
+ Zufallsfrage: '.($db->db_parse_bool($row->zufallfrage)==true?'Ja':'Nein').'
+ Zufallsvorschlag: '.($db->db_parse_bool($row->zufallvorschlag)==true?'Ja':'Nein').'
+ Startlevel: '.($row->level_start!=''?$row->level_start:'Keines').'
+ Höheres Level nach: '.($row->level_sprung_auf!=''?$row->level_sprung_auf.' richtigen Antwort(en)':'-').'
+ Niedrigeres Level nach: '.($row->level_sprung_ab!=''?$row->level_sprung_ab.' falschen Antwort(en)':'-').'
+ Levelgleichverteilung: '.($db->db_parse_bool($row->levelgleichverteilung)==true?'Ja':'Nein').'
+ Maximalpunkte: '.$row->maxpunkte.'
+ Antworten pro Zeile: '.$row->antwortenprozeile.'
+
+
GebietNummerLevelFrageGesamt (m/w)Nummer | Punkte | Gesamt | Männlich | Weiblich
+ + + + + + + + + '; + } + } + else + echo '
Keine Detaildaten vorhanden'; + $i=0; while($row = $db->db_fetch_object($result)) { @@ -255,6 +260,8 @@ if(isset($_GET['show'])) } echo '
GebietNummerLevelFrageGesamt (m/w)Nummer | Punkte | Gesamt | Männlich | Weiblich
'; } + else + echo 'Keine Detailauswertung vorhanden'; } ?> diff --git a/cms/admin.php b/cms/admin.php index 3edcde68f..4d12bcd39 100644 --- a/cms/admin.php +++ b/cms/admin.php @@ -1248,13 +1248,17 @@ function print_content() echo '

Vorschau

'; + if($content->sichtbar!=true) + { + echo '

(Unsichtbar im Livesystem)

'; + } //Bei Redirects wird die Vorschau nicht im IFrame gezeigt, da durch eventuelles weiterleiten durch // Javascript in der Vorschau die CMS Seite geschlossen wird. if($content->template_kurzbz=='redirect') echo 'Vorschau in eigenem Fenster öffnen'; else - echo '